Riding a motorcycle on the road requires a license. The following are precautions for riding a motorcycle: 1. Wear a helmet: This is very important. Develop the good habit of wearing a helmet. Safety comes first. Don’t skip wearing a helmet just because the weather is too hot in summer. There are breathable and cooler helmets suitable for summer use, so there’s no need to wear the heavy, airtight ones designed for winter. 2. Slow down, slow down, slow down: Unlike cars, motorcycles are less safe. If you’re not very familiar with riding, always go slow. This way, even if you need to brake suddenly, you can stay steady. Beginners should never overestimate their control abilities. 3. Don’t force carrying passengers: If you can’t handle it, never force yourself to carry someone. Not only does it increase the risk of falling and injuring people, but it can also easily cause traffic accidents on the road. Always strictly follow traffic rules.
